Resolve to protect noble culture - President

The Poson Poya is an ideal opportunity for all Sri Lankan Buddhists to resolve protect Buddhism and our noble culture, President Chandrika Bandaranaike Kumaratunga says in her Poson message.

She said: "The Poson Poya is important for Sri Lankan Buddhists not only because Arahant Mahinda brought us the message of the Dhamma, but also because the very foundation of our nation, our heritage and culture stemmed from that event. We became a peaceful nation due to the influence of Buddhism.

"Arahant Mahinda taught us the lesson of compassion. He told us that man as well as other animals have the freedom to roam wherever they wish. This philosophy led to a great social revolution. This message is valid more than ever today, when we are trying to solve crucial problems.

"What we need today is a society that knows the value of patience and eschews revenge and violence. We need a barrier-free society that respects the right of all citizens to go about their daily business freely."
